Veterans Appeals Efficiency Act
Official: Veterans Appeals Efficiency Act of 2025
The Veterans Appeals Efficiency Act aims to streamline how the Department of Veterans Affairs handles claims and appeals for veterans' benefits. By improving reporting and tracking, it seeks to reduce delays in processing these claims.

1. This bill requires the Secretary of Veterans Affairs to submit an annual report on claims processing times. 2. It establishes guidelines for speeding up the review of certain veterans' claims. 3. The bill mandates tracking of specific claims to improve efficiency in the benefits process. 4. It aims to enhance communication about the status of claims for veterans seeking benefits.
Veterans seeking benefits from the Department of Veterans Affairs.
